How patient data flows

  1. Your practice signs in through one suite account (Supabase

identity). Identity and billing systems never receive patient data.

  1. Files you process (e.g. photos for a montage) travel over TLS to

our EU servers, are processed, and are deleted within 24 hours

unless you save the case.

  1. Saved cases and practice settings live in your practice's own

storage partition, readable only by your practice's signed-in

users.

  1. Model improvement uses your content **only if your practice enables

it** (off by default; logged consent; revocable).

Measures

  • TLS 1.2+ for all transport; HSTS on all public hosts.
  • Encryption at rest on server volumes and backups.
  • Logical per-practice data segregation enforced in the application

layer on every request.

  • Least-privilege access: production access limited to named

administrators with MFA; administrative actions logged.
